Hybrid Inference Routing & Local Vector Architectures

We combine small quantized models (SLMs) for task routing with larger frontier models for deep execution. Internal prototype measurements suggest significantly lower compute cost and reduced latency versus a monolithic cloud LLM approach. Results require independent validation.

Technology Maturity · NASA/ESA TRL Framework

Honest Technology Readiness Status

We use the Technology Readiness Level (TRL) framework to communicate our maturity honestly. Core systems are currently at TRL 3–4: validated in prototype, advancing toward external deployment validation.

TRL 1–2
Concept & Feasibility
Basic principles observed. Technology concept formulated. Initial experimental proof of concept.
← Now
TRL 3–4
Prototype Development
Analytical and laboratory validation of components. Internal test environment demonstrating routing, orchestration, and schema guardrails.Current Stage
TRL 5–6
Component Validation
Technology validated in relevant environment. Pilot deployments with design partners. Independent external benchmarking.
TRL 7
System Prototype Demo
System prototype demonstrated in operational environment. First commercial client deployments.Target
TRL 8–9
Operational Deployment
System complete and qualified. Proven in operational environment across multiple deployments.
